- ESS Series 10 KW Models
The TDK-Lambda ESS Series 10 kW models are high-performance, high-density constant voltage/constant current (CV/CC) programmable DC power supplies. Housed in a compact 5U rack-mount chassis, these systems deliver reliable power ranging from 7.5V to 600V DC and currents up to 1000A. Standard analog programming and monitoring, multiple protection diagnostics, and optional digital interfaces make the ESS Series ideal for demanding industrial and laboratory applications.
Specifications
General
| Parameter | Value |
|---|---|
| Interfaces | Analog programming & monitoring (standard); RS-232 / IEEE-488 GPIB (optional) |
| Display | Separate analog meters for voltage and current (standard); digital LED meters (optional) |
Physical
| Parameter | Value |
|---|---|
| Power Supply | 190 - 250 VAC or 342 - 456 VAC (option dependent), 3-phase, 47 - 63 Hz |
| Operating Temperature | 0 to 50 °C |
| Dimensions (W×H×D) | 482.6 x 222.2 x 558.8 mm (19" x 8.75" x 22") |
| Weight | 38.6 kg (85 lbs) |
DC Output Specifications
| Parameter | Value |
|---|---|
| Maximum Output Power | 10 kW |
| Output Voltage Range | 10 to 600 VDC (model dependent) |
| Output Current Range | 16 to 1000 A (model dependent) |
| Line Regulation (Voltage) | 0.1% of maximum rated output voltage |
| Load Regulation (Voltage) | 0.1% of maximum rated output voltage |
| Line Regulation (Current) | 0.1% of maximum rated output current |
| Load Regulation (Current) | 0.1% of maximum rated output current |
AC Input Specifications
| Parameter | Value |
|---|---|
| Input Voltage Range | 190 - 250 VAC (standard) or 342 - 456 VAC (optional), 3-Phase |
| Input Frequency Range | 47 - 63 Hz |
Analog Programming and Control
| Parameter | Value |
|---|---|
| Remote Analog Programming Voltage | 0 - 5 V or 0 - 10 V (selectable) |
| Remote Analog Programming Resistance | 0 - 5k Ohm or 0 - 10k Ohm (selectable) |
| Output Voltage Monitor Signal Level | 0 - 5 V or 0 - 10 V |
| Output Current Monitor Signal Level | 0 - 5 V or 0 - 10 V |
| Remote On/Off Control Interface | Standard contact closure or TTL signal compatibility |
| Standard Front Panel Control | Ten-turn potentiometers for voltage and current adjustment |
Protection and Diagnostics
| Parameter | Value |
|---|---|
| Over-Voltage Protection (OVP) Trip Range | Adjustable |
| Over-Voltage Indicator | Standard LED indicator |
| Phase Loss Protection | Standard LED indicator and shutdown protection |
Physical and Mechanical
| Parameter | Value |
|---|---|
| Chassis Rack Units (U) | 5 U |
| Cooling System Type | Internal fan forced cooling |
| Multi-Unit Connectivity | Capable of series or parallel operation for higher power systems |
Environmental Conditions
| Parameter | Value |
|---|---|
| Storage Temperature Range | -40 to +85 °C |
Performance
| Parameter | Value |
|---|---|
| Voltage Programming Accuracy | 0.5% of maximum rated output voltage |
| Current Programming Accuracy | 1.0% of maximum rated output current |
| Voltage Temperature Coefficient | 0.02% of rated output voltage per °C |
| Voltage Stability | 0.05% of rated output voltage over 8 hours |
| Current Stability | 0.1% of rated output current over 8 hours |
| Efficiency | 85% typical at full load |
